The DIP to PLCC44 Adapter Board is an effective and low-cost board for DIP to PLCC44 conversion. You just have to plug a PIC into this adapter. After the programming process is finished, you can remove it from the adapter.

Tap inside the car diagnostic systems
OBD II to DB9 cable enables you to connect with your car’s OBD-II system. You just need to plug OBD II connector on one end to your car and the other end it into some sort of hardware interface which has a DB9 connector, like our OBD II click. The overall length of the cable is five feet (152cm).

OBDII click offers a unique opportunity to tap into the car diagnostic systems. It features the STN1110 Multiprotocol OBD to UART Interface, developed by the ScanTool technologies. This click can be used for the communication with the Electronic Control Unit (ECU) of a vehicle, via several different OBD II diagnostic protocols such as CAN, K LINE, L LINE and J1850. The STN1110 IC is used to process requests sent by the MCU via the UART interface and return back the responses from the ECU network nodes.

CAN FD 3 Click is a add-on board based on TLE9251V CAN network transceiver, designed for HS CAN networks up to 5 Mbit/s in automotive and industrial applications. As an interface between the physical bus layer and the CAN protocol controller, the TLE9251V drives the signals to the bus and protects the microcontroller against interferences generated within the network. Given all the features its components offer, the CAN FD Click is best used for for infotainment applications, gateway modules, body control modules (BCM) or engine control units (ECUs).
CAN FD 3 Click board™ is supported by a mikroSDK compliant library, which includes functions that simplify software development. This Click board™ comes as a fully tested product, ready to be used on a system equipped with the mikroBUS™ socket.
